• Home
  • History
  • Annotate
  • Raw
  • Download
  • only in /netgear-R7000-V1.0.7.12_1.2.5/components/opensource/linux/linux-2.6.36/drivers/scsi/

Lines Matching refs:OptionsString

3311 static int __init BusLogic_ParseDriverOptions(char *OptionsString)
3317 while (*OptionsString != '\0' && *OptionsString != ';') {
3319 if (BusLogic_ParseKeyword(&OptionsString, "IO:")) {
3320 unsigned long IO_Address = simple_strtoul(OptionsString, &OptionsString, 0);
3345 } else if (BusLogic_ParseKeyword(&OptionsString, "NoProbeISA"))
3347 else if (BusLogic_ParseKeyword(&OptionsString, "NoProbePCI"))
3349 else if (BusLogic_ParseKeyword(&OptionsString, "NoProbe"))
3351 else if (BusLogic_ParseKeyword(&OptionsString, "NoSortPCI"))
3353 else if (BusLogic_ParseKeyword(&OptionsString, "MultiMasterFirst"))
3355 else if (BusLogic_ParseKeyword(&OptionsString, "FlashPointFirst"))
3358 else if (BusLogic_ParseKeyword(&OptionsString, "QueueDepth:[") || BusLogic_ParseKeyword(&OptionsString, "QD:[")) {
3360 unsigned short QueueDepth = simple_strtoul(OptionsString, &OptionsString, 0);
3366 if (*OptionsString == ',')
3367 OptionsString++;
3368 else if (*OptionsString == ']')
3371 BusLogic_Error("BusLogic: Invalid Driver Options " "(',' or ']' expected at '%s')\n", NULL, OptionsString);
3375 if (*OptionsString != ']') {
3376 BusLogic_Error("BusLogic: Invalid Driver Options " "(']' expected at '%s')\n", NULL, OptionsString);
3379 OptionsString++;
3380 } else if (BusLogic_ParseKeyword(&OptionsString, "QueueDepth:") || BusLogic_ParseKeyword(&OptionsString, "QD:")) {
3381 unsigned short QueueDepth = simple_strtoul(OptionsString, &OptionsString, 0);
3389 } else if (BusLogic_ParseKeyword(&OptionsString, "TaggedQueuing:") || BusLogic_ParseKeyword(&OptionsString, "TQ:")) {
3390 if (BusLogic_ParseKeyword(&OptionsString, "Default")) {
3393 } else if (BusLogic_ParseKeyword(&OptionsString, "Enable")) {
3396 } else if (BusLogic_ParseKeyword(&OptionsString, "Disable")) {
3402 switch (*OptionsString++) {
3414 OptionsString--;
3421 else if (BusLogic_ParseKeyword(&OptionsString, "BusSettleTime:") || BusLogic_ParseKeyword(&OptionsString, "BST:")) {
3422 unsigned short BusSettleTime = simple_strtoul(OptionsString, &OptionsString, 0);
3428 } else if (BusLogic_ParseKeyword(&OptionsString, "InhibitTargetInquiry"))
3431 else if (BusLogic_ParseKeyword(&OptionsString, "TraceProbe"))
3433 else if (BusLogic_ParseKeyword(&OptionsString, "TraceHardwareReset"))
3435 else if (BusLogic_ParseKeyword(&OptionsString, "TraceConfiguration"))
3437 else if (BusLogic_ParseKeyword(&OptionsString, "TraceErrors"))
3439 else if (BusLogic_ParseKeyword(&OptionsString, "Debug")) {
3445 if (*OptionsString == ',')
3446 OptionsString++;
3447 else if (*OptionsString != ';' && *OptionsString != '\0') {
3448 BusLogic_Error("BusLogic: Unexpected Driver Option '%s' " "ignored\n", NULL, OptionsString);
3449 *OptionsString = '\0';
3466 if (*OptionsString == ';')
3467 OptionsString++;
3468 if (*OptionsString == '\0')